Mix and match
Monitor’s latest announcement highlights the increasingly blurry line between independent and public providers of NHS-funded healthcare.
The former will now be regulated and licensed as well, to protect both patient and provider.
As trusts can make more and more profit through competition, it is worth considering the long-term consequences of a more mixed healthcare sector. The government has repeatedly made assurances that greater competition will lead to improved care. But many concerns have been raised about moving further away from a health service that is fundamentally free at the point of delivery.
